Route Overview

The San Jose Airport to El Mangroove Resort route is a long-distance private transfer from Costa Rica’s Central Valley to the northern Pacific coast of Guanacaste. El Mangroove Resort is located near Playa Panamá in the Gulf of Papagayo region, a coastal area known for calm beaches, luxury resorts, marina access, dry tropical forest, and convenient access to Playas del Coco and Playa Hermosa.

Private transportation is especially useful for this route because the drive is long and begins at Costa Rica’s busiest international airport. A driver can meet you after arrival, assist with luggage, coordinate around flight delays when flight details are provided, and take you directly to the resort without requiring a rental car, public bus connection, or separate transfer from Liberia.

The journey usually starts at Juan Santamaría International Airport near Alajuela and travels northwest toward Guanacaste using Route 1, the Inter-American Highway. After passing the Liberia area, the route continues toward the Papagayo coastal corridor and Playa Panamá. Travel time can vary because of airport traffic, road work, rain, holiday congestion, and slower traffic near coastal access roads.

What Makes This Route Unique

This route connects Costa Rica’s main international airport with one of the most convenient resort areas in Guanacaste. El Mangroove Resort is close to Playa Panamá, Playa Hermosa, Playas del Coco, Culebra Bay, and Liberia Airport, but many travelers still arrive through San Jose Airport because of international flight availability, pricing, or itinerary plans.

No ferry is required for this transfer, which makes the route more predictable than trips to some Nicoya Peninsula destinations. The full journey is completed by road through inland Guanacaste and the Gulf of Papagayo coastal region.

The route also shows a major change in scenery. Travelers leave the airport zone and Central Valley traffic, continue through highway towns and Guanacaste cattle country, pass dry tropical forest landscapes, and arrive near the calm bay waters and resort coastline of Playa Panamá.

Schedule and Pickup

Private transportation from San Jose Airport to El Mangroove Resort is scheduled around your preferred pickup time. For airport arrivals, flight tracking, delay monitoring, and pickup coordination are important when accurate flight details are provided in advance.

The driver typically meets travelers after they exit customs and baggage claim at Juan Santamaría International Airport. This helps make the arrival process smoother and gives passengers a direct connection to their vehicle before beginning the long drive to Guanacaste.

Morning and early afternoon departures are generally preferred for this route because the transfer is long and the final section near Playa Panamá and the Gulf of Papagayo is easier to reach in daylight. Late arrivals can still be coordinated, but travelers should allow extra time for traffic, road conditions, and nighttime driving.

Travel Tips

Provide your airline, flight number, and arrival time in advance so airport pickup can be coordinated if your flight is delayed.

Confirm the exact destination as El Mangroove, Autograph Collection, near Playa Panamá in Guanacaste Province.

No ferry is required, but the route is long, so plan for flexible arrival timing and possible rest stops.

Keep essentials such as passports, medication, chargers, snacks, water, swimwear, and valuables in a small carry-on bag during the transfer.

Expect warmer and drier conditions as the route moves from the Central Valley into Guanacaste’s northern Pacific region.

Avoid scheduling time-sensitive dinners, spa appointments, or activities immediately after arrival if your flight lands in the afternoon.

FAQs

How long is the drive from San Jose Airport to El Mangroove Resort?

The drive from San Jose Airport to El Mangroove Resort usually takes about 4.5 to 5.5 hours, depending on traffic, weather, road work, and the exact arrival conditions.

Is a ferry required from San Jose Airport to El Mangroove Resort?

No ferry is required. The route is completed entirely by road from the Central Valley to Guanacaste’s Gulf of Papagayo region.

Where is El Mangroove Resort located?

El Mangroove Resort is located near Playa Panamá in Guanacaste Province, close to the Gulf of Papagayo, Playa Hermosa, Playas del Coco, and Liberia Airport.

Is private transportation better than a shared shuttle for this route?

Private transportation is better for flexible airport pickup, direct resort drop-off, flight coordination, privacy, and luggage assistance. A shared shuttle may cost less but follows fixed schedules.

Can the driver track my San Jose Airport flight?

Yes, flight tracking and delay coordination are typically available when accurate flight details are provided before arrival.

Is Liberia Airport closer to El Mangroove Resort than San Jose Airport?

Yes. Liberia Airport is much closer to El Mangroove Resort, but many travelers still use San Jose Airport because of flight availability, pricing, or itinerary plans.

Can I take public transportation from San Jose Airport to El Mangroove Resort?

Public bus travel is possible toward Liberia or nearby beach towns, but it usually requires multiple connections and additional local transportation. It is not ideal with luggage.
